Hi all,
I remember posting on the nvda-devel list a while ago regarding removing
code paths marked as deprecated in the screen reader source code. Last time
I asked if anyone is using i18n names for synth settings ring and received
no responses from coders who actually uses these, which implies that it is
safe to remove this.
The other code paths in NVDA Core that are marked as deprecated include:
* Speech.reason* constants
* synthDriverHandler. SynthDriver: speakText and speakCharacter
methods
* config. validateConfig
* config.val
* config.save
If any of you (NVDA Core and add-on maintainers) are using any of the above,
please speak up before February 28, 2017. If I hear from nobody, I'll create
a NVDA Core pull request in March proposing that the above code paths be
removed before end of 2017. Thanks.
